![The Pumping Unit In Anthemy](https://images.stockfreeimages.com/thumb/06apnhgzo9.jpg)
The Pumping Unit In Anthemy - The Photo Taken In China's Heilongjian Province Daqing City,daqing Oil Field.The Time Is September 18, 2013. Photo
© Xishuiyuan | Stock Free Images
Pro Stock Photos From Dreamstime
Similar Free Images
Categories: